Acta Cryst. (2002). A58, 75-76 [ doi:10.1107/S0108767301016725 ]
Abstract: A theorem is proven which provides a sufficient condition that an isometry is a symmetry of a composite constructed from a component and a group of isometries. The concept of latent symmetry is broadened and this theorem is applied to deduce latent symmetry of example composites, including an example discussed by Litvin & Wadhawan [Acta Cryst. (2001), A57, 435-441], the latent symmetry of which could not be determined there systematically.
Keywords: latent symmetry.
